结论:企业级物联网平台服务器配置应以高可用性、可扩展性和安全性为核心,结合业务规模和数据处理需求选择合适的硬件与云服务组合。
-
企业在部署物联网(IoT)平台时,服务器配置是决定系统性能和稳定性的关键因素之一。由于连接设备数量的增长和数据量的激增,合理的资源配置能够保障平台的高效运行。
-
核心考量之一是计算能力(CPU)。物联网平台通常需要处理大量并发连接和实时数据分析,因此建议选择多核高性能CPU,如Intel Xeon或AMD EPYC系列,以支持高并发任务调度和数据处理。
-
内存(RAM)容量也至关重要。由于IoT平台常涉及消息队列、流式处理(如Kafka、Flink)以及数据库写入操作,建议至少配置64GB以上内存,甚至在大规模场景下推荐128GB或更高,确保系统在高负载下仍能保持响应速度。
-
存储方面,应优先采用SSD硬盘,提升I/O读写效率。对于数据存储架构,可以采用分级策略:热数据使用高速NVMe SSD缓存,冷数据归档至成本更低的HDD或对象存储(如AWS S3、阿里云OSS)。
-
网络带宽和延迟控制也不容忽视。物联网平台常常面临海量设备同时上传数据的情况,因此服务器应配备千兆以上网卡,必要时可采用负载均衡(如Nginx、HAProxy)和CDNX_X,保障数据传输的稳定性和低延迟。
-
高可用性和灾备机制是企业级部署的标配。建议采用主从架构、集群部署(如Kubernetes),并配合自动故障转移(Failover)机制,避免单点故障导致服务中断。
-
安全性方面,需配置防火墙、入侵检测系统(IDS)、SSL/TLS加密通信等防护措施,防止设备伪造接入和数据泄露。此外,建议启用设备身份认证(如X.509证书、OAuth2)和访问控制策略。
-
如果选择云服务器而非自建数据中心,可以根据业务弹性需求选用公有云(如AWS IoT Core、Azure IoT Hub、阿里云IoT平台)提供的托管服务,节省运维成本的同时获得更好的伸缩性。
-
对于中小型企业,初期可从4核8G起步,逐步过渡到16核64G以上的配置;而对于大型企业或工业级IoT项目,则建议直接部署分布式架构,利用容器化技术实现微服务管理。
综上所述,企业物联网平台的服务器配置必须根据实际应用场景灵活调整,兼顾性能、安全与成本效益。合理的技术选型和架构设计不仅能支撑当前业务需求,还能为未来的扩展打下坚实基础。
CDNK博客